vim-patch:8.1.0709: windows are updated for every added/deleted sign

Problem:    Windows are updated for every added/deleted sign.
Solution:   Do not call update_debug_sign().  Only redraw when the line with
            the sign is visible.  (idea from neovim vim/vim#9479)
